How to fill out import forms and documents

Illustration

How to fill out import forms and documents

01
Start by collecting all the necessary import forms and documents, such as customs declaration forms, commercial invoices, packing lists, and bill of lading or airway bills.
02
Make sure to have the correct import codes and descriptions for your products, which will be needed for customs classification and tariff calculation.
03
Fill out the necessary information on the import forms, including details about the imported goods, such as quantity, value, country of origin, and harmonized system codes.
04
Provide accurate and complete information about the exporter, importer, and any intermediaries involved in the import process.
05
Include any additional supporting documents required for specific types of imports, such as permits, licenses, certificates of origin, or sanitary/phytosanitary certificates.
06
Review and double-check all the entered information for accuracy and completeness.
07
Submit the filled-out import forms and documents to the relevant customs authorities or shipping agents, either physically or electronically.
08
Pay any applicable customs duties, taxes, or fees associated with the importation of the goods.
09
Keep copies of all the filled-out import forms and documents for your records and future reference.
10
Monitor the status of your import documentation to ensure smooth customs clearance and delivery of the imported goods.

Who needs import forms and documents?

01
Import forms and documents are needed by various entities involved in international trade and customs operations, including:
02
- Importers: Individuals or businesses that bring goods into a country from overseas.
03
- Exporters: Individuals or businesses that ship goods to other countries.
04
- Customs authorities: Government agencies responsible for regulating and controlling imports.
05
- Shipping agents: Organizations involved in handling and facilitating the transportation of goods across borders.
06
- Trade intermediaries: Brokers, freight forwarders, or agents who assist importers/exporters with customs procedures and documentation.
07
- Regulatory agencies: Entities that require specific import forms and documents for compliance purposes, such as health or safety regulations.
08
- Financial institutions: Banks or lenders that may require import documentation for trade financing or payment processing.
09
- Insurance providers: Companies that need import documents for insuring goods during transit.
10
- Legal authorities: Law enforcement or legal entities that may require import documentation for inspection or investigation purposes.

Import forms and documents are official paperwork required to bring goods into a country legally.
Import forms and documents must be filed by individuals or companies bringing goods into a country.
Import forms and documents can be filled out online or submitted in person at the customs office.
The purpose of import forms and documents is to declare the goods being imported and provide necessary information for customs clearance.
Import forms and documents typically require information such as the description of goods, quantity, value, and country of origin.
